Care Supervisor

1 week ago


Lisburn, United Kingdom Connected Health Full time

Join our team as a Care Supervisor and play a pivotal role in delivering exceptional care to our service users. Working alongside your Area Manager and our dedicated team, you'll be responsible for ensuring the safe and effective provision of care to all of our service users. As the direct point of contact for colleagues regarding service users in your area, you'll be instrumental in coordinating care efforts and providing support where needed. If you're ready to make a difference and take on a rewarding challenge, we want to hear from you

**MAIN DUTIES**

**COMMUNITY**:

- Will be responsible for completing shadowing with new staff and completing relevant paperwork.
- Monitor and complete 6 and 12 weekly reports regarding performance of new staff members
- and ensure paperwork is uploaded and accurate.
- Be accountable for the quality and maintenance of Client Care folders on a monthly basis. Returning Daily record sheets to office. Ensuring that all personal details are up-to-date and folders are off a high standard.
- Work alongside the Area Manager to complete client monitoring visits and client reviews.
- Work alongside the Area Manager to complete regular spot checks with frontline staff.
- Ensure new client's folders are placed in clients home within 24 hours at POC starting.
- Ensure weekly delivery of PPE to all ground staff.
- Participate in emergency cover when required.
- To provide direction, guidance and support to care staff
- Support in the audits of all processes to ensure high quality care
- Ensure that accurate and concise records are maintained at all times including client assessments and
- staff compliance for example mandatory training records
- Provide leadership and motivation which is conducive to good staff relations and effective work
- performance.
- Manage, develop and support staff, individually and as a team, including induction, probation,
- supervisory support and training, including supervisory staff
- Report immediately to the
- Area Manager any incidents of poor practice or any matters that are prejudicial
- to the welfare of the service user.
- To provide emergency adhoc cover, ensuring all care hours are delivered, review why emergency cover had to be delivered and explore proactive plans
- To cover on-call in absence of manager
- To support at the weekend in emergency situations
- Engage in business contingency as required by the business, review reasons and work with the
- manager to provide proactive plan

**OFFICE**:
To participate in the on-call phone on alternative weekends.

To participate on updating the QP platform with any changes to rostering when it's your working weekend.

Completion of weekend handover required.

To work with your Area Manager on rostering if staff shortages/sickness

To report/complete any paperwork for any issues/concerns from staff/clients

directly to your Area Manager.

Communicate/report to Care Managers/Social Workers when required.

To participate in further training to develop your skills within your role.

***ESSENTIAL CRITERIA**

**Minimum 1 years care experience**

**Must be a driver with access to own car
**Must be Fully Flexible regarding**

**working hours.**

Desirable Criteria

**NVQ Level 2/3 desirable. Must be willing to work towards level 3.**

**Currently NISCC registered**
